Abstract

This study aimed to analyze the effect of the implementation of Safety Management System (SMS) and the use of information system on the Flight Safety in the Indonesian Air Navigation Services Organization both partially and simultaneously. The research uses quantitative methods, and the data are analyzed using linear regression, simple correlation both partially and simultaneously and path analysis. The result shows; implementation of Safety Management System (X1) as measured by the Flight Safety (Y) has a positive and significant contribution on the level of Flight Safety.  The amount of the application contribution of Safety Management System that directly contributes to the Flight Safety is 35.4%, so the research hypothesis which states that the Safety Management System application directly impacts significantly on Aviation Safety is accepted; the use of Information Systems (X2) as measured by the Flight Safety (Y) has a positive and significant contribution on the level of Flight Safety. The use of information systems contributions that directly contributes to aviation safety is 38.4%, so the hypothesis which states that the use of information system directly affects significantly the flight safety is acceptable; the total effect of simultaneous application of Safety Management System (X1) and the use of Information Systems (X2) contribute significantly to the Flight Safety (Y) as much as 66.3%. The remaining 33.7% is the influence of the other factors such as refresher and development training for air navigation personnel, aviation navigation equipment renewal and observation flight
